Stability AI’s new AI model turns photos into 3D scenes


Stability AI has released a new AI model, a stable virtual camera that the company claims they can transform 2D footage into “immersive” videos with realistic depth and perspective.

Virtual cameras are tools often used in digital filming and 3D animation to capture and navigate scenes in real time. With a stable virtual camera, stability intended to add generative AI to the mix to deliver greater control and customizability, the company said in a Blog post.

A stable virtual camera generates “new views” of a scene of one or more images (up to 32 overall) at camera angles that a user specifies. The model can generate videos that travel along “dynamic” room paths or presets including “spiral”, “Dolly Zoom”, “Move” and “Pan.”

The current version of a stable virtual camera, research forecast, can generate videos in a square (1: 1), a portrait (9:16), and a landscape (16: 9) appearance proportions up to 1,000 frames in length. Stability warns that the model can produce less high quality results in some scenes, yet especially with images with humans, animals or “dynamic textures” such as water.

“Very ambiguous scenes, complex room pathways that intersect objects or surfaces, and irregularly shaped objects can cause lightning artifacts,” stability notes on its blog, “especially when target views differ significantly from the input images.”

A stable virtual camera is available for research use under non -commercial license. It can be downloaded from the Ai Dev Hugging Face platform.

Stability, the troubled company behind the popular image -generation model Stable dissemination,, raised new money last year As investors including Eric Schmidt and Napster founder Sean Parker sought to turn the business. Emad Mostaque, the co -founder and former CEO of Stability, reportedly misused stability into financial ruin, leading personnel to resign, a partnership with Canva to fall, and investors will grow worried about the company’s prospects.

In recent months, stability has hired a new CEO, appointed Titanic director James Cameron to his board, and released several new image -generation models. Earlier in March, the company joined with a ragged arm To bring AI model, which can generate sound including sound effects to mobile devices running arms.
